Fix 3: Check My Optus Server Is Down Or Not

If My Optus is not working then there are chances that there are some bug or glitch in My Optus App or My Optus server is down. 

There are many ways to check if My Optus server is down or if there is some bug/ glitch in My Optus.

First way is go to downdetector >> Search for My Optus >> check if there is spike in the graph or not.

If there is spike then either My Optus server is down or there is some bug.

Another way is just search on Twitter “My Optus down”.

You can check latest tweets regarding same or not.

In this case, you can’t do anything so just wait for some time until the bug is resolved by My Optus team or My Optus server is up.

Fix 5: Clear My Optus App Cache

Most of time, when there is some issue with My Optus app, clearing the app cache will resolve the issue. 

So, To fix the My Optus app issue, clear My Optus app cache.

To clear the My Optus App cache,

For Android users, Go to settings >> Find My Optus App and click on that >> Tap on clear cache >> My Optus App cache will be cleared.

For iPhone users, Go to iPhone settings >> Go to General >> Find My Optus App and click on that >> Tap on iPhone Storage >>  Tap on Offload App button >> Again Reinstall My Optus app.

Check My Optus app working or not after Clearing the app cache.

Note: Available screens, settings or steps for clearing the cache may vary by software version, and phone model.

My Optus App Notification Not Working

My Optus app notification not working because you have not enabled the notification for My Optus app.

For Android users, Go to settings >> Go to apps >> Tap on My Optus app >> Toggle ON notification.

For iPhone users, Go to Settings >> Tap on notifications >> Scroll down and Tap on My Optus app >> Toggle ON notifications.

Notification will be enabled for My Optus app.

Note: Available screens, settings or steps may vary by software version, and phone model.
